Human Resources Administrative Support

Full Time Clerical Jacksonville, FL, US

The HR Admin role provides administrative and secretarial support to the HR department. In addition to typing, filing, and scheduling, the HR Admin performs duties such as timekeeping, payroll assistance, coordination of meetings and conferences, obtaining supplies, coordinating direct mailings, and working on special projects. Also, answers non-routine correspondence and assembles highly confidential and sensitive information. Deals with a diverse group of important external callers and visitors as well as internal contacts at all levels of the organization. Independent judgment is required to plan, prioritize, and organize a diversified workload and to recommend changes in office practices or procedures.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
  •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
  • Assists with routine maintenance and auditing employee personnel files, records, and documentation to ensure accuracy and up-to-date.
  • Assists or answers frequently asked questions from applicants and employees relative to standard policies, benefits, hiring processes, etc.; refers more complex questions to appropriate HR personnel.
  • Conducts or assists with hiring events and new hire orientation.
  • Schedules and organizes complex activities such as meetings, travel, conferences, and gateway activities for all members of the gateway.
  • Performs desktop publishing. Assists with creating and developing visual presentations for the gateway or HR department.
  • Establishes, develops, maintains, and updates the filing system for the HR department.
  • Conducts daily ADP maintenance as required, including entering employees in the time clock and general troubleshooting to ensure time clocks are fully functional (becomes resident expert). -
  • Performs daily audits of time clock punches and makes required corrections daily.
  • Performs daily audits of scheduled hours vs actual hours worked.
  • Updates employee attendance personnel files as required and provides local HR and Leadership with the appropriate follow-up to disciplinary action weekly
  • Conducts wellness checks via phone call for employees on leave or with extended absenteeism.
  • Handles confidential and non-routine information and explains policies when necessary.
  • Works independently and within a team on special nonrecurring and ongoing projects. Acts as project manager for special projects, at the request of the HR department, which may include planning and coordinating multiple presentations, disseminating information, coordinating direct mailings, and creating brochures.
  • Assists with general correspondence, memos, charts, tables, graphs, etc. Proofreads copy for spelling, grammar, and layout, making appropriate changes.
  • Other duties as assigned.
